ABOUT FOOD BANKS CANADA

Food Banks Canada supports a unique network of over 3,000 food-related organizations in every province and territory that provides support to Canadians who visit food banks over 1.1 million times each month. Together, the network annually shares over 200 million pounds of essential safe, quality food; and provides social programs that help to foster self-sufficiency, and advocates for policy changes that will help create a Canada where no one goes hungry.
